На паскале 8 класс 1) дано число а, верно ли утверждение, что сумма его цифр больше некого числа к, а само число а - четное. 2) дано число а, верно ли утверждение, что первая его цифра равна х, а последняя у, а также само число не четное
139
151
Ответы на вопрос:
//pascalabc.net//версия 3.3, сборка 1634 (14.02.2018) 1)begin var a: =readstring('a-> '); println('сумма больше ',a.joinintostring(' ').tointegers.sum> readinteger('k-> ')? 'true': 'false'); println('a четное ',a.tointeger.iseven); end. пример: a-> 123456 k-> 22 сумма больше false a четное true 2) begin var a: =readinteger('a-> '); println('a нечетно',a.isodd); var b: =a.tostring.joinintostring(' ').tointegers; println('первая равна x',b.first=readinteger('x-> ')? 'true': 'false'); println('последняя равна y',b.last=readinteger('y-> ')? 'true': 'false'); end. пример: a-> 456485 a нечетно true x-> 5 первая равна x false y-> 5 последняя равна y true
var sum, i, s: integer; //обыявляем необходимые переменные
//sum - сумма, i - кол-во слогаемых, s - само слогаемоеbegin //начало sum : = 0; i : = 1; s : = 5; //первое слогаемое = 5 repeat sum : = sum + s; //к сумме прибавляем слагаемое s : = s + 4; //увеличиваем слогаемое i : = i + 1; //увеличиваем кол-во слогаемых until (sum = 324); //выход когда сумма равна 324 writeln ('слогаемых: '); // выводим кол-во слогаемых write (i); end. //конец
Популярно: Информатика
-
shybite27.01.2022 10:30
-
Анастасия2004198122.12.2022 22:59
-
arhipflina19.07.2020 23:14
-
Pwdrddiwkekfiwldkeie24.10.2021 18:06
-
dimat12325.04.2023 20:23
-
нуралик09.07.2022 01:51
-
VaBaGaBa11.08.2022 09:54
-
klokova049otccwt10.04.2020 04:58
-
eva7021814.03.2021 15:22
-
sprinter9926.11.2021 22:22